Shrubs Removal in Honolulu, HI
Shrubs remov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of unwanted or overgrown shrubs to improve the appearance and safety of a property. This service covers a variety of projects, including clearing out overgrown hedges, removing dead or damaged shrubs, preparing landscapes for new planting, or creating open space for other outdoor features. Homeowners typically request shrub removal to enhance curb appeal, prevent pests, or address safety concerns caused by overgrown or diseased plants.
Before requesting shrub removal, property owners should consider the size, location, and number of shrubs to be removed, as well as any potential impact on existing landscaping. It’s also helpful to understand whether the removal involves stump grinding or complete removal, including roots, to ensure the project meets specific landscape goals. Clarifying these details can help determine the scope of work and ensure the project aligns with overall yard maintenance or redesign plans.
